The AirChek TOUCH by SKC is a touchscreen personal air sampling pump offering a broad flow range of 5–5,000 ml/min without an adapter, and 0.005–0.5 LPM in low-flow mode with an adapter, making it one of the most versatile pumps available for industrial hygiene sampling. It delivers ±5% flow accuracy per ISO 13137:2022 and provides up to 20 hours of battery life per charge. Rated intrinsically safe for Class I, Division 1 hazardous environments, it is ideal for a wide range of chemical, dust, and vapor sampling applications in manufacturing, construction, mining, and laboratory environments.

What is the SKC AirChek Touch used for?
It's a wearable personal air sampling pump that pulls a controlled airflow through sampling media — filter cassettes, sorbent tubes, or impactors — so a lab can determine worker exposure concentration. It covers 1–5 LPM standard flow and 5–500 ml/min low-flow with the included adapter, handling most OSHA and NIOSH personal sampling methods in one unit.
AirChek Touch vs. GilAir Plus — what's the practical difference?
Both cover similar flow ranges for personal IH sampling. The AirChek Touch is known for its touchscreen interface, automatic flow correction, and ISO 13137:2022 certification. The GilAir Plus offers constant-flow and constant-pressure modes without external adapters. Choose based on your team's workflow, interface preference, and whether the site requires a specific intrinsic safety certification.
Is the AirChek Touch intrinsically safe?
Yes — it's UL-certified Intrinsically Safe, Class I, Division 1, Groups A–D. This matters when sampling in environments with flammable gases or vapors. Confirm the exact area classification with your safety team and keep the certification documentation with the sampling kit.
How do I verify flow before sampling?
Connect the full sampling train (pump, tubing, cassette or tube, adapter), set your target flow on the touchscreen, then confirm actual flow using a primary flow calibrator. Document the verified flow as part of your chain of custody. Re-verify any time you change media type, tubing length, or add the low-flow adapter.
How long will the battery last for a full shift?
Up to 20 hours at 2,000 ml/min and 10 hours at 5,000 ml/min. For an 8–12 hour shift, match your flow setting to those figures and start with a full charge. Use screen lock to prevent accidental changes, and document any on/off periods so your total sampled volume is accurate.
What causes a sample to be rejected by the lab?
Almost always documentation or handling failures — not pump failure. Missing start/stop times, unrecorded flow changes, unlabeled media, or contamination during transport are the common culprits. Keep a complete chain of custody: media ID, worker/task, verified flow, and times. A technically sound sample with incomplete paperwork is still unusable for compliance decisions.
What's included in the AirChek Touch rental kit?
The kit includes the AirChek Touch pump, charging/communication cradle, cassette holder with Tygon tubing and Luer adapter, low-flow adapter with SKC tube cover (70mm), black tubing, mini-USB cable, power supply, and software/manuals on USB. Sampling media (filters, sorbent tubes) and lab analysis are not included.

Features & Capabilities

Intrinsically Safe: ✓ Yes
Monitoring Scope: Personal Monitoring

Equipment Specifications

  • Nominal Flow Range:
  • 5 – 500 ml/min (0.05 - 0.5LPM) withlow flow adapter required
  • 1,000 – 5,000 ml/min (1 - 5LPM) constant flow
  • Pressure Drop Capability:
  • 5000 ml/min at 20 in. water
  • 4000 ml/min at 30 in. water
  • 3000 ml/min at 40 in. water
  • 2000 ml/min at 50 in. water
  • 1000 ml/min at 50 in. water
  • Flow Control Accuracy:± 5% of set-point
  • Operating Time:
  • 20 hrs at 2000 ml/min
  • 10 hrs at 5000 ml/min
  • Indefinite when in cradle
  • Charging:~3 hrs with cradle; chainable up to 5 units
  • Environmental Ranges:
  • Operating temp: 32 to 104 °F (0 to 40 °C)
  • Storage temp: -4 to 113 °F (-20 to 45 °C)
  • Humidity: ≤ 95% RH, non-condensing
  • Altitude: Compensates up to 15,000 ft above sea level
  • Display:Color LCD, resistive touch screen with lock and auto-dim
  • Parameters Displayed:Flow rate, ambient temp, ambient pressure, accumulated volume, elapsed time
  • Tubing:1/4 in. ID required
  • Certifications:
  • UL Intrinsically Safe (Class I, Div. 1, Groups A-D; Class II, Div. 1, Groups E-G; Class III, Div. 1)
  • CE, UKCA
  • ISO 13137:2022 compliant
